a.The weight of '50 g' bags of potato chips is normally distributed with a mean of 50.2 grams and a standard deviation of 5grams.
i.Calculate the standard deviation of the sampling distribution of the average weight of the '50 g' potato chip bag for samples of size 5. Give your answer correct to 4 decimal places. [2]
If a customer buys a pack of 5 potato chip bags, what is the probability that the average weight of these 5 potato chip bags will be between 51 grams and53grams?
a.John wants to find a new investment for his portfolio. He considers the following options for investment:
Stocks: John was offered stock of NAB. The average return of this stock is 14% with a standard deviation of 10%.
ETFs: Another option is the Exchange-Traded Fund (ETF), which tracks the performance of the S&P 200 index. The ETF offers an average return of 13% with a standard deviation of 7%.
By calculating the coefficients of variation for both shares, determine which investment option would be considered riskier and explain why.
